Table III.
Causes of Infant Deaths, 1921 to 1930.
1921 | 1922 | 1923 | 1924 | 1925 | 1926 | 1927 | 1928 | 1929 | 1930 |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Diarrhoeal Diseases | 9 | 5 | 2 | 4 | 1 | 4 | 3 | 5 | 4 | 3 |
Premature Birth | 10 | 5 | 11 | 7 | 9 | 23 | 20 | 14 | 25 | 14 |
Congenital Defects | 4 | 6 | 8 | 10 | 5 | 9 | 6 | 4 | 9 | |
Atrophy, Debility, Marasmus | 12 | 10 | 9 | 6 | 8 | 13 | 11 | 6 | 10 | 9 |
Tuberculous Disease | — | 2 | 1 | 3 | — | — | — | 2 | 1 | 2 |
Syphilis | 2 | — | — | — | 1 | 1 | — | — | — | — |
Rickets | — | — | — | — | - | - | - | - | - | - |
Meningitis [not Tuberculous) | 1 | — | 1 | 2 | 1 | 1 | — | 1 | 3 | 1 |
Convulsions | 2 | 2 | 2 | 2 | — | 1 | 2 | 3 | 3 | 6 |
Bronchitis | 6 | 5 | 5 | 1 | 4 | 7 | 5 | 7 | 2 | 4 |
Pneumonia (all forms) | 9 | 1 | 10 | 3 | 5 | 5 | 7 | 4 | 8 | 10 |
Gastritis | 1 | 2 | 1 | — | — | 1 | — | 1 | 1 | — |
Common Infectious Diseases | 7 | 4 | 2 | 3 | 3 | 1 | 2 | — | 6 | 2 |
Other Causes | 9 | 15 | 10 | 11 | 12 | 9 | 15 | 12 | 6 | 11 |
Totals | 72 | 57 | 62 | 46 | 54 | 71 | 74 | 61 | 73 | 71 |
